Medieval castle Dobra Kuća (meaning "Good House", also Hungarian: Dobrakutya) was an important fortification of the region in the Middle Ages.
Dobra Kuća, owned by various persons, was a vivid centre of then rich country.
The market town of Dobra Kuća was mentioned in 1510s, it belonged to Bjelovar-Križevci County.
Ottoman troops captured the castle in 1542 and henceforth controlled it by a guard of thirty men.
Following the retreat of Ottomans, Dobra Kuća fell into decay and disrepair.
